PACIFIC NORTHWEST BALLET ANNOUNCES MILLION-DOLLAR GIFT FROM FRIDAY FOUNDATION, TO END
by Sondra Forsyth - October 20, 2020

Pacific Northwest Ballet is honored to announce the receipt of a million-dollar gift from the Friday Foundation. With this gift – designated to the Pacific Northwest Ballet Foundation – PNB has created a new endowment, the Jane Lang Davis New Works Fund. Annual income from the invested fund will be used in perpetuity to provide support for one new ballet each season, and/or support the full breadth of PNB’s New Works initiative, including workshops for emerging artists....
